Witekio vs Softeq Development: overview

Witekio

Witekio was founded in 2001 and is headquartered in Lyon, France, with a team in the 51-200 range (reported variously between 164 and 200 depending on the source). The firm positions itself as a chip-to-cloud embedded software provider for device makers, covering embedded systems consulting, BSP/Android/Linux/RTOS/firmware development, OTA and security, and C++ application development (Qt, Flutter) on top of that. For a CTO comparing boutique European embedded shops, Witekio's breadth across the full device-to-cloud chain — rather than a single-layer specialty like a pure Linux or pure RTOS shop — is the distinguishing trait, at the cost of not having one narrow area of maximal depth.

Softeq Development

Softeq Development, founded in 1997 by Christopher A. Howard and headquartered in Houston, Texas, has grown past 500 employees offering full-stack development spanning low-level firmware and drivers, hardware from PCB to full-scale devices, and application software across web, desktop, and mobile. For a CTO comparing this to smaller embedded-only boutiques, the trade-off is straightforward: Softeq's broader full-stack capability (including consumer-facing app development) means one vendor can cover an entire connected-product program end to end, but embedded/hardware work sits alongside — not ahead of — the firm's general software development practice, so buyers specifically prioritizing embedded depth should confirm the dedicated hardware team's bench strength directly.

Witekio vs Softeq Development: pros and cons

Witekio
+ Full chip-to-cloud coverage — BSP, firmware, connectivity, security, and application layer (Qt/Flutter) — under one team rather than stitched across vendors
+ OTA update and device security are explicit named specialties, directly relevant to connected-product liability concerns
+ 20+ years of focused embedded software history since its 2001 founding, with no diversification into unrelated verticals
- Reported team size varies by source (roughly 150-200), making exact delivery capacity somewhat imprecise
- Breadth across the full stack trades off against the narrowest possible depth in any single layer compared to single-focus boutiques
- No public pricing tiers or minimum engagement figures for budget pre-qualification
Softeq Development
+ Full-stack coverage — hardware/PCB, low-level firmware and drivers, and consumer application software — under one contracted engagement
+ 27+ years of history since its 1997 founding, with 500+ employees supporting programs at moderate-to-large scale
+ US headquarters simplifies contracting and IP considerations for domestic clients wary of offshore-only teams
- Embedded/hardware work is one practice area within a broader full-stack development business, not the firm's sole specialization — verify dedicated hardware team depth directly
- US-based delivery may carry a rate premium relative to nearshore or offshore boutique alternatives
- No public pricing or minimum engagement figures published
